- [Instructor] Once you've set up a grade book in D2L, it's time to use it to its fullest, allowing your students to track their grades and progress. We're going to talk about providing feedback in a grade book in two ways. First, on individual assignments and second on overall course performance. With individual assignments like this one, our term paper assignment, if you've already associated a submission folder with a grade book item and provided feedback within that submission folder, the feedback will automatically populate the grade book item here. In other words, any scores, comments, or rubric-based input will automatically appear associated with the individual items. If a grade book item isn't already populated, though, select the dropdown arrow next to the grade book item and then choose Grade All.
